New Release: TO MARK THE OCCASION: BIRTHDAY TALES FOR JANE AUSTEN'S 250th
TO MARK THE OCCASION, a short story anthology to commemorate Jane Austen's 250th. I wrote the short "Mary Crawford's Debut." Dear friends, I hope, even if Austen isn't your cup of tea, you will buy the anthology to read my story and, more importantly, support a great cause. All proceeds from this anthology will be donated to the Jane Austen Literacy Foundation, founded by Jane Austen's 5th great niece, Caroline Jane Knight.
